Over the 12 months ending 2026-09-03, 5 recorded sales closed at a median of $360,000, $181 per square foot, a median 20 days on market, sellers accepting 97% of original asking. At the median price and Gwinnett County's 2025 rate of 27.1 mills, annual property tax runs about $3,900.

Bellewood's pricing right now comes down almost entirely to the individual home, not a shared amenity package or a uniform build era. With a median price of $360,000 against a median of $180.58 per square foot, the math points to condition, layout, and lot as the swing factors buyer to buyer rather than any community-wide premium.
A median of 20 days on market says offers are moving at a normal, unhurried pace for this price point rather than facing the bidding compression you'd see in a tighter, amenity-driven market. With only five closings in the current window, the sample is thin enough that any single sale can move the read meaningfully, so pricing a listing or evaluating an offer here should lean on the specific comp, not the neighborhood average alone.

The Bellewood buying strategy.
If we were buying in Bellewood today, this is the order of operations we would run for our clients.
Underwrite the condition first. Price the roof, HVAC, and systems honestly before judging any list price; condition swings value here more than square footage alone.
Match the home to real comps. Recent sales of similar condition and lot, not the asking price, tell you what a home is worth.
Move deliberately, not desperately. Neither side has a decisive edge, so a well-prepared, fairly-priced offer wins without overpaying.
Line up financing and inspection early. A pre-approval and an inspection plan let you act fast and negotiate from evidence.

What the numbers are actually telling you
The spread implied by a $360,000 median price and $180.58 per square foot suggests this is a market where finish level and square footage do the pricing work, not a fixed-amenity premium layered on top. Buyers comparing two homes here should expect the price-per-square-foot math to move more with condition and updates than with anything the community itself provides.
Twenty days of median time on market is a reasonable, middle-of-the-road pace: not a sign of urgency, not a sign of stagnation. Combined with a closings window of only five sales, it means the current snapshot is a real but limited read — useful for framing a conversation, not for treating as a fixed price ceiling or floor.
